Competitive Analysis — Europe & Global

Platform Country / Region Description Charity Involvement
The Animal Rescue Site (https://theanimalrescuesite.com/) USA (global reach) Online store where every purchase supports shelter animals by funding food, medical care, etc. Users can also select a specific animal to donate to via the homepage. Every purchase funds food and care for animals; charity is built into the business model.
KIKA Lithuania Lithuanian pet store chain with online shop. Known for its accessibility and local presence. Partners with shelters, promotes pet adoptions in stores, collects donations offline.
Zooplus Germany / EU Leading online retailer of pet supplies in Europe. Wide assortment, fast delivery to most EU countries. Offers customers to donate loyalty points to animal welfare organizations.
Petstore.com USA (global shipping) Online marketplace for unique and premium pet goods. Vendors can donate a portion of their sales to animal charities (optional feature).
Pets at Home UK Large chain of pet stores with strong online presence and in-store vet services. Runs the Pets at Home Foundation, supports rescue centers and adoption programs.
Amazon Pets Global Category on Amazon for pet products. Wide selection, fast shipping, prime delivery. No integrated charity system; AmazonSmile program was discontinued in 2023.
